There are today 196 companies plus partners developing 282 targeting actin cytoskeleton modulator drugs in 1,242 developmental projects in cancer. In addition, there is 1 suspended drug, and the accumulated number of ceased drugs over the last years amounts to another 168 drugs. Identified drugs are linked to 164 different targets.

All included targets have been cross-referenced for the presence of mutations associated with human cancer. To date, 162 out of the 164 studied drug targets so far have been recorded with somatic mutations. Pipeline Breakdown According to Number of Drugs

  • Marketed - 27
  • Pre-registration - 4
  • Phase III - 38
  • Phase II - 117
  • Phase I - 145
  • Preclinical - 132
  • No Data - 4
  • Suspended - 1
  • Ceased - 168
